Wastrel


noun
1.
a wasteful person; spendthrift.
2.
Chiefly British.

refuse; waste.
a waif; abandoned child.
an idler or good-for-nothing.

noun
1.
a wasteful person; spendthrift; prodigal
2.
an idler or vagabond
